Introduction of GSTR 9 All the entities having GST registration as regular taxpayers are required to file annual return in form GSTR 9 for the financial year 2017-18 irrespective of their turnover during the return period. Hence an entity having no transaction during the year is also required to file GSTR 9. A registered taxpayer […]

The date of filing of Form GST CMP-02 for availing Composition Levy under Notification No-02/2019 is extended to 31st July 2019. From 21st June, Rule 138E of CGST Rules is applicable and those persons who have not filed 2 consecutive return is debarred to generate E-way bill. This date is also extended to 21st August 2019.
